Cruden Street - N1 8NJ
Key Postcode Insights
N1 8NJ is a residential postcode situated on Cruden Street, London, N1 with 15 addresses.
It ranks as the 868th largest and 1953rd most expensive of the 2,112 postcodes in the N1 area. The most common property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The postcode contains a total of 15 properties: 12 houses and 3 flats.
